
One hears about different types of prayer including prayers of intercession. Prayers of intercession generally occur when we ask God to intercede in a situation usually for someone else but also for us.
Recently, as I was asking for God’s intercession, I actually asked Him to interfere. And I was struck that perhaps that is more what I intend and prefer. Intercession seems rather civilized and passive. But interfere? That has tones of active meddling where perhaps it isn’t welcome. For some of the people and governments I am praying for that is exactly what God’s activity would be: interference.
But I also find God’s interference is sometimes exactly what is needed. Including in my own life.
